Beckley, WV; The Alice Lloyd College Eagles (1-1) traveled to Appalachian Bible on September 12th to face the home-standing Warriors (1-2) in soccer action. When the dust had settled, the Caney Creek club emerged victorious, 5-2.
The scoring started for the visitors when Maddux Camden drilled the first goal of the day on a nice assist from Sawyer Crum (1-0).
From there, Dylan Moore would connect off a Dakota Noble assist to put the Eagles ahead 2-0. Later in the match, Camden would hit pay dirt again (3-0).
Eventually, Crum would give ALC their fourth goal (4-0). Finally, River Conley would close out the Eagle scoring with a nice shot of his own (5-0). ABC would then add two late scores to set the final tally at 5-2.
On the day, the victors (1-1) fired 22 shots, compared to ABC's 15. Alice Lloyd goalie Joseph Westphal registered 7 saves and allowed just 2 scores., ALC committed 7 fouls, compared to the hosts with 6. Both squads had 6 corner kicks.
